Lifeguard Dog

A lifeguard dog that was banned from a British beach will be back on duty this summer after hundreds of people signed a petition to get him back.

Normal dogs are banned from some beaches in Britain, but Newfoundland lifeguard dog Bilbo got around that by sitting in his owner's beach buggy during his patrols.

But when officials decided that wasn't safe, Bilbo was banned too.


Now about 1,500 people have signed a petition to get him classed as a working dog to see him back on patrol.
